Harrison is located in Henry County, Indiana. Harrison has a 2025 population of 1,413. Harrison is currently growing at a rate of 0.43% annually and its population has increased by 1.36%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 1,394 in 2020.
The average household income in Harrison is $95,164 with a poverty rate of 4.22%. The median age in Harrison is 45.7 years: 47.1 years for males, and 40.5 years for females.

Harrison's average per capita income is $46,190. Household income levels show a median of $85,735. The poverty rate stands at 4.22%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$99,167 | - |
Households | $85,735 | $95,164 |
Families | $79,531 | $96,345 |
Non Families | $45,278 | $70,194 |
